> > > How can you execute a backup from the command line?
> >
> >    Not sure of your question, but here is one way!
> >    tar -czpsf home.tar.gz /home
> >    will tar and gzip the /home directory tree to a file home.tar.gz.
> >    Then move home.tar.gz file to another server for storage.
